Output 8e2467179aaeb7bcc255ea7c3c61f1dc50f15cf0d67540b42439a0e26fa49b87:9

value
5582516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d4cf305f91607418c48b80eab318be1b43f5cc2 OP_EQUAL
address
MC2gpbRcM6VzZig8ub96KZpAVTFY3MCfwJ
transaction
8e2467179aaeb7bcc255ea7c3c61f1dc50f15cf0d67540b42439a0e26fa49b87
spent
true